Q: Is 489,012 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 489,012 is not a prime number.

Why is 489,012 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 489012 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 12 40,751 81,502 122,253 163,004 244,506 and 489,012, with no remainder.

Since 489,012 cannot be divided by just 1 and 489,012, it is not a prime number.
